Of course, the biggest news is that the announcement of the impending release of Dungeons & Dragons 4th Edition has happened today. Don't worry, the new edition is a year away. They also talk about the new edition being evolutionary rather than revolutionary. They ARE talking about incorporating online play for the first time through a new Website, DnDInsider.com. Each paper product will include codes to unlock digital versions on the site for a "nominal" activation fee. Players will also be able to use DnDInsider tools and access regular new content similar to the material that was previously released in Dragon and Dungeon magazines for a monthly fee (as yet undetermined) greater than the old subscription price, but less than a MMORPG subscription. Magazine-style content will be added to the site three times a week and compiled into digital "issues" monthly.
